Method

Sausage

1

Prepare sausages

Pat sausages dry with paper towel. Using a sharp knife make shallow diagonal slits across each sausage (3–4 shallow cuts) to help cooking and let sauce penetrate.

2

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add 1 tbs vegetable oil. When oil shimmers, add sausages and sear, turning every 2–3 minutes until browned on all sides, about 8–10 minutes total.

3

Reduce heat to medium-low, add 1 tsp butter if using, cover and cook 4–6 minutes more until sausages are cooked through (internal temperature 160°F/71°C for pork). Remove sausages to a cutting board and keep warm.

4

Slice sausages into 1/2-inch thick rounds on the diagonal and set aside. Reserve pan drippings for the sauce.

Curry ketchup sauce

5

In a small bowl whisk together 1 cup water with 2 tbs tomato paste until smooth to make a tomato slurry.

6

Return the skillet with reserved drippings to medium heat. If pan is too dry, add 1 tsp oil. Add ketchup, tomato slurry, 2 tbs brown sugar, 2 tbs apple cider vinegar, 1 tsp Worcestershire sauce,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 1 tsp paprika, 1 tsp turmeric (if using), 1 tsp black pepper, and 3 tsp salt. Stir to combine.

7

Bring mixture to a gentle simmer, then reduce heat to low. Stir in 2 tbs curry powder and simmer uncovered 6–8 minutes, stirring occasionally, until sauce thickens slightly and flavors meld. Taste and adjust seasoning—add more vinegar for brightness, sugar for sweetness, or salt as needed.

8

If you prefer a very smooth sauce, transfer to a blender or use an immersion blender and puree until smooth, then return to pan and reheat gently.

Finish & serve

9

Place sliced sausages back into the skillet with the sauce and toss gently to coat and warm through, about 1–2 minutes.

10

Transfer sausages to plates or a serving platter. Spoon extra curry ketchup over the top. Sprinkle 2 tsp curry powder evenly over each portion for the characteristic currywurst finish and dust with chopped parsley if using.

11

Serve immediately with fries or crusty rolls and extra sauce on the side.
